
Manx Rally star David Higgins has hit out at organisers of Saturday's International Rally Yorkshire, after having to drive around a digger coming towards him on the third stage.
Higgins came over a blind crest at 100 m.p.h. to be confronted by the vehicle in the middle of the road.
